July27°C average high
July is one of Montreal's warmest months, with daytime heat above the yearly average.
Warmest monthsMay to September
This stretch sets the upper range for average daytime heat.
July93mm average rain
July is wetter than Montreal's yearly average, so flexible plans matter more.

July8.6 hours average sun
July is one of Montreal's sunniest months, with some of the strongest bright-day conditions in the yearly averages.
